Beginning in lower Manhattan and moving uptown to the Upper East Side and West Side,you'll come upon hundreds of important historical sites and landmarks representing 300 years of the city's growth and development. Revealing trips to Brooklyn and Queens spotlight examples of surviving 17th-century Dutch Colonial architecture,historic neighborhoods,and a treasure trove of buildings displaying virtually every architectural style.
